    Abstract: A method for synchronizing data, via a broadcast network, which includes at least one fixed transmitter and a plurality of broadcast sites. The synchronization method uses the following acts, at at least one of the broadcast sites: obtaining a delay, referred to as an absolute delay, determined from the geographic location of the broadcast site; determining an additional delay, by subtracting the absolute delay from a fixed delay shared by the broadcast sites in the network; resetting at least one time datum or at least one portion of a data stream from the fixed transmitter, applying the additional delay to the time datum or to the portion of the data stream.

    Abstract: The invention relates to a surface wave antenna system, comprising at least one antenna that is electrically short in the vertical plane, with vertical or elliptic polarization and emitting a radiation, said antenna being linked to a conducting medium exhibiting a substantially horizontal surface. The antenna system being characterized in that it comprises furthermore at least one parasitic wire extending in a direction substantially parallel to the surface of the conducting medium, electrically insulated from each antenna, and arranged in the vicinity of at least one antenna in such a way as to be able to radiate by virtue of the current induced by said radiation of this antenna. The invention makes it possible to combine the resultants of each radiating element in such a way as to control the radiation pattern in the vertical plane.

    Abstract: A method for generating time marking for synchronous terrestrial broadcasting in at least one single-frequency zone of at least one audiovisual stream via at least one connection in which the at least one audiovisual stream is multiplexed with at least one other audiovisual stream broadcast via the at least one connection, the method including: inserting packets including at least one item of information representing a common reference clock, detecting at least one packet including information representing the number of days elapsed since a predetermined date, calculating the number of loopbacks of a counter during a given period, updating the counter at each packet of the audiovisual stream transmitted, inserting at least one packet including the value of the updated counter in the audiovisual stream in order to form a modified audiovisual stream and transmitting the modified audiovisual stream.

    Abstract: The metrological device, for example for a broadcasting network, for monitoring an upline broadcast signal includes a main component and upline control data. The metrological device includes an extraction circuit for extracting the upline control data from the upline broadcast signal and delivering an upline instruction, and a measuring circuit for measuring a parameter of the upline broadcast signal according to the upline instruction and delivering a measurement result. A control circuit produces a downline instruction from the measurement results and an upline result produced by the extraction circuit from the upline control data, and an insertion circuit produces a downline signal to broadcast comprising firstly the main component of the upline broadcast signal and secondly the downline control data containing the downline instruction.

    Abstract: A method is provided for broadcasting a data stream in a network including at least two separate transmitters supplied by a head end. The stream is organized into data frames and includes at least one time marker. The method includes the following steps at the head end: obtaining a first time reference from an external source; obtaining a second time reference from the data stream received by the head end; comparing the first and second time references in order to determine a time shift between the first and second time references; and transmitting the time shift or at least one time marker modified on the basis of the time shift in order to compensate for a transport time variation between the head end and the transmitters.

    Abstract: The antenna comprises a metal excitation loop (B1) to be positioned at a height (h) of at least about 1 above the surface (SM) of a conducting medium (M) and a supply means (A, L1n) to be connected to the conducting medium. The perimeter of the loop is about one half of the operating wavelength, namely ?/2, in length. The loop comprises two approximately parallel portions (I1p-I1n, S1) which are at most about ?/50 apart and are capable of extending approximately parallel to said surface in a plane approximately perpendicular to said surface, currents of opposite direction flowing through said portions. The closest portion to said surface includes an aperture between ends (E1p, E1n) of the loop that are connected to the supply means. The antenna is better protected from space waves and it can be reduced in size by being folded up.

    Abstract: To broadcast synchronized radio waves in at least one frequency band in a predetermined territory, antennas (AS, ATI, AE) emit waves to respective coverage areas in which receivers (RQ, RB) measure characteristics of the emitted waves and transmit to a central server (SC) . The server analyzes the characteristics (CO) as a function of prediction models for broadcasting waves in the territory in order to determine adjustment parameters for the antennas. The server transmits the adjustment parameters to the antennas to control them in order to offer a greater diversity of radio broadcasting services and to optimize coverage areas according to different wave propagation modes.

    Abstract: A method for reinforcing a metal tubular structure (1) including the following steps: introducing inside the metal tubular structure (1), a plurality of substantially linear elements (4) having a tensile strength higher than a predetermined value; and injecting a curable filling product inside the metal tubular structure, so that the curable filling product contacts an inner surface of the metal tubular structure (1) and coats the substantially linear elements (4) of said plurality of elements.

    Abstract: A method of measuring the degradations in a digitized image, which are introduced during the encoding of the image is provided. The method consists in: retrieving the block decomposition of the image used during the encoding thereof; offsetting the coding grid in relation to the image such as to define an analysis block decomposition of the image, whereby each analysis block covers a boundary between two adjacent blocks; applying a transform calculation to the pixel data of the image which is encoded using the offset coding grid; extracting the transformed coefficients obtained for each analysis block, coefficients which are likely to be affected by a block effect; applying an inverse transform calculation to the extracted transformed coefficients in order to determine the pixel data of each analysis block; and, for each analysis block, calculating a degradation indicator and, subsequently, the degradation of the image from the degradation indicators for each analysis block.
